Adriatic Azure, Custom Crafted Sailing

QUEEN OF ADRIATIC yacht available for charter. Built in 2008 with a charter price from €17,900 for up to 14 guests in 6 suites with a crew of 4.

Launched in 2008 and meticulously refitted in 2023, this 26.8-metre sailing yacht offers an intimate exploration of the East Mediterranean. With a comfortable cruise speed of 9 knots, she glides gracefully between ancient coastlines and secluded coves. Accommodating fourteen guests across six cabins, each journey promises a seamless blend of traditional sailing charm and contemporary comfort, all under the Croatian flag. Her generous 7.5-metre beam provides expansive deck spaces for relaxation and socialising.

The Crew

A professional crew of 4 dedicated to your charter. Working language: English.

Goran Rogulj
Captain

Goran Rogulj

Croatia · English

The captain Goran is a skilled and enthusiastic captain with extensive experience in the yachting industry since 2010. Born in 1977, he is an electromechanic by profession, which helps him to effectively apply his experience in ship maintenance. Even though he's professional and silent person, he's very knowledgeable and can always advise on best places to visit. Before he fell in love with gulets, he worked as a skipper on sailboats and went shell diving. Diving still remained one of his favorite hobbies and occasionally he also engages in sport fishing. Goran is fluent in Croatian and English. During his free time, the Captain can often be seen racing the ski slopes, enjoying his second love - skiing.

Stipe Bajan
Sailor

Stipe Bajan

Croatia · English

Born in 2001, Stipe completed his education at a technical traffic school. During his summer breaks, he frequently found himself cleaning sailboats, which marked the beginning of his journey. In 2019, following his father's encouragement, he embarked on a new chapter by becoming a sailor in the crew of a gulet. He is responsible for various tasks to ensure the smooth operation of the boat and the safety and comfort of guests on board. Stipe is fluent in Croatian and English. When interacting with guests, he enjoys listening to their stories, learning about their culture, customs and language. During his leisure time, he makes an effort to relax and explore as much as possible, sometimes escaping to the mountains for a well-deserved break.
